I still like the game and play on a regular basis. Over this time period I have played a type of chemin de fer called "The Take it Leave it Method". You will not get flush with this tactic or defeat the casino, still you will have a lot of fun. This method is founded on the idea that chemin de fer appears to be a match of streaks. When you’re hot your on fire, and when you are not you’re NOT!
I wager with basic strategy blackjack. When I lose I bet the lowest amount allowed on the subsequent hand. If I lose again I wager the lowest amount allowed on the successive hand again etc. Once I win I take the winnings paid to me and I bet the original bet again. If I win this hand I then leave the winnings paid to me and now have double my original bet on the table. If I succeed again I take the payout paid to me, and if I succeed the next hand I leave it for a total of four times my original wager. I keep betting this way "Take it Leave it etc". Once I do not win I lower the wager back down to the original value.
I am very disciplined and do not "chicken out". It gets very fun at times. If you win a few hands in a row your wagers go up very fast. Before you realize it you are betting $100-200/ hand. You must understand that you can lose much faster this way too!. But it really makes the game more enjoyable. And you will be surprised at the runs you witness wagering this way. Here is a guide of what you would wager if you continue winning at a 5 dollar game.
Wager $5
Take 5 dollar paid-out to you, leave the original 5 dollar bet
Bet $5
Leave five dollar paid-out to you for a total bet of 10 dollar
Wager 10 dollar
Take 10 dollar paid-out to you, leave the original $10 bet
Bet 10 dollar
Leave ten dollar paid to you for a total bet of twenty dollar
Wager $20
Take $20 paid to you, leave the original 20 dollar wager
Wager twenty dollar
Leave $20 paid-out to you for a total bet of forty dollar
Wager 40 dollar
Take forty dollar paid to you, leave the original forty dollar bet
Bet 40 dollar
Leave forty dollar paid to you for a total bet of 80 dollar
Wager eighty dollar
Take 80 dollar paid to you, leave the original $80 bet
Wager 80 dollar
Leave 80 dollar paid to you for a total bet of 160 dollar
Wager 160 dollar
Take 160 dollar paid to you, leave the first 160 dollar wager
If you departed at this point you would be up three hundred and fifteen dollars !!
It’s herculean to go on a run this long, but it can happen. And when it does you can NOT deviate and lower your bet or the final result will not be the same.
